#4b0f26 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b0f26 is composed of 29.4% red, 5.9%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80% magenta, 49.3%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 337 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 17.6%. #4b0f26 color hex could be obtained by blending #961e4c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#4b0f26 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b0f26 has RGB values of R:75, G:15,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.49,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 4919078.

Shades and Tints of #4b0f26
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0205 is the darkest color, while #fef8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b0f26
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f2b2c is the less saturated color, while #590123 is the most saturated one.
